We have an almost 10 year old mixed baby girl. We took advantage of the Wellness Days FREE office visit for the heartworm check. While there, we got the Parvo vaccination updated and, it whacked out her immune system within 2 weeks (beware of this, never knew it could happen). I called, a few days after spotting bruises on her inner thighs...she has a history with allergies and, at first I thought it was them returning yet again. They had me take her right in and, discovered that her platelet count was dangerously low. We were given medicine and, told to keep her calm and quiet...which was easy since she had no energy. After visiting every other day for 10 days for bloodwork, we have come to greatly appreciate the kindness they've shown not only to us but to our baby as well.
